Investing.com – Finland equities were higher at the close on Monday, as gains in the Telecoms, Financials and Healthcare sectors propelled shares higher.
At the close in Helsinki, the OMX Helsinki 25 added 0.74%.
The biggest gainers of the session on the OMX Helsinki 25 were Valmt (HEL:VALMT), which rose 2.42% or 0.26 points to trade at 11.02 at the close. Elisa Oyj (HEL:ELI1V) added 1.92% or 0.59 points to end at 31.26 and Stora Enso Oyj R (HEL:STERV) was up 1.87% or 0.160 points to 8.715 in late trade.
Biggest losers included Outotec Oyj (HEL:OTE1V), which lost 3.12% or 0.190 points to trade at 5.895 in late trade. Outokumpu Oyj (HEL:OUT1V) declined 2.09% or 0.0880 points to end at 4.1240 and Nokia Oyj (HEL:NOK1V) shed 0.62% or 0.040 points to 6.390.
Advancing stocks outnumbered falling ones by 110 to 65 and 4 ended unchanged on the Helsinki Stock Exchange.
In commodities trading, Brent oil for September delivery was down 4.84% or 2.52 to $49.69 a barrel. Meanwhile, Crude oil for delivery in September fell 3.78% or 1.78 to hit $45.34 a barrel, while the December Gold contract fell 0.42% or 4.60 to trade at $1090.50 a troy ounce.
EUR/USD was down 0.30% to 1.0952, while EUR/GBP fell 0.07% to 0.7025.
The US Dollar Index was up 0.26% at 97.58.
